Recognizing the Role of a Building Electrician

Building and construction electrical experts play a crucial role in the building and restoration of frameworks, ensuring that all electric systems are set up properly, safely, and effectively. They are in charge of the configuration of circuitry and electrical parts in different types of building projects, consisting of property, industrial, and industrial structures. This specialized area requires not just technical expertise however likewise an understanding of the current building ordinance and regulations that govern electrical installments.

One of the main duties of a construction electrician is to read and translate blueprints and technological layouts. This ability permits them to identify the locations for outlets, switches, and various other electric fixtures. By recognizing plans and requirements, building and construction electrical experts can successfully connect with various other tradespeople on the job website, making sure that every person is worked with to satisfy task timelines and security criteria. Their capability to adhere to comprehensive strategies is crucial for maintaining the honesty of the electrical system throughout the building process.

Safety and security is vital in construction, and construction electrical experts are trained to implement and comply with strict security procedures. Electric job comes with intrinsic risks, consisting of exposure to live wires and potential electric hazards. As a result, building and construction electricians need to equip themselves with the ideal safety equipment and methods to shield themselves and their colleagues. They may also be accountable for making sure that the workplace is secure for all employees involved in the building project, making security recognition a top concern.

In addition to setup, building electricians typically engage in troubleshooting and repair work throughout and after building and construction. They examine electric systems for problems and guarantee that everything is operating as planned. Comprehending how to identify problems allows electrical experts to remedy them rapidly, conserving time and costs for task management. Additionally, maintaining abreast with new modern technologies and methods in electric engineering is essential, as the market remains to advance with innovations that boost energy performance and electrical safety and security.

The Art of Micro Dispensing: Unlocking Precision and Efficiency

Micro dispensing is a highly specialized technique used in various industries, including manufacturing, pharmaceuticals, and electronics. It involves the precise delivery of small amounts of liquids, pastes, or powders onto a surface or substrate. This process requires a high degree of accuracy and control, making it a critical component in the production of complex devices and systems. In this article, we will delve into the world of micro dispensing, exploring its applications, benefits, and the various techniques used to achieve precision and efficiency.

1. Applications of Micro Dispensing

Micro dispensing is used in a wide range of applications, from the production of microelectromechanical systems (MEMS) to the creation of pharmaceutical formulations. In the electronics industry, micro dispensing is used to apply conductive materials, such as solder paste or wire, to create complex circuits and interconnects. In the pharmaceutical industry, micro dispensing is used to apply precise amounts of active ingredients to create customized formulations. In the medical device industry, micro dispensing is used to apply biocompatible materials, such as bone cement or tissue adhesives, to create implantable devices.

2. Benefits of Micro Dispensing

The benefits of micro dispensing are numerous, including increased precision, reduced waste, and improved efficiency. By using micro dispensing techniques, manufacturers can achieve high levels of accuracy and consistency, reducing the risk of errors and defects. Micro dispensing also allows for the use of smaller amounts of materials, reducing waste and minimizing the environmental impact of production processes. Additionally, micro dispensing enables the creation of complex devices and systems that would be impossible to produce using traditional manufacturing techniques.

3. Techniques Used in Micro Dispensing

There are several techniques used in micro dispensing, each with its own unique advantages and applications. One of the most common techniques is the use of syringe-based dispensing systems, which involve the use of a syringe to dispense small amounts of material onto a surface. Another technique is the use of piezoelectric dispensing systems, which use a piezoelectric material to create a precise and controlled flow of material. Other techniques include the use of inkjet dispensing systems, which use a combination of pressure and heat to create a precise and controlled flow of material.

4. Dispensing Tips and Nozzles

Dispensing tips and nozzles are critical components in micro dispensing systems, as they determine the accuracy and precision of the dispensing process. Dispensing tips and nozzles come in a variety of shapes and sizes, each designed for specific applications and materials. Some common types of dispensing tips and nozzles include round tips, flat tips, and tapered tips. The choice of dispensing tip or nozzle will depend on the specific requirements of the application, including the type of material being dispensed and the desired level of precision.

5. Factors Affecting Dispensing Accuracy

Several factors can affect the accuracy of the dispensing process, including the type of material being dispensed, the temperature and humidity of the environment, and the condition of the dispensing tip or nozzle. The viscosity of the material being dispensed can also affect the accuracy of the dispensing process, as can the flow rate and pressure of the dispensing system. By understanding these factors and taking steps to control them, manufacturers can achieve high levels of accuracy and consistency in their micro dispensing processes.

6. Calibration and Maintenance

Calibration and maintenance are critical components of micro dispensing systems, as they ensure that the system is functioning accurately and consistently. Calibration involves adjusting the dispensing system to ensure that it is dispensing the correct amount of material, while maintenance involves cleaning and replacing worn or damaged components. Regular calibration and maintenance can help to extend the life of the dispensing system and ensure that it continues to function accurately and consistently.

The Metallurgical Lab: Unraveling the Mysteries of Metal and Mineral Analysis

In the world of metallurgy, understanding the properties and composition of metals and minerals is crucial for a wide range of applications, from extracting valuable resources to developing new technologies. A metallurgical lab plays a vital role in this process, providing scientists and engineers with the tools and expertise needed to analyze and characterize the physical and chemical properties of metals and minerals. In this article, we’ll delve into the world of metallurgical labs, exploring their functions, techniques, and importance in the field of metallurgy.

1. What is a Metallurgical Lab?

A metallurgical lab is a specialized facility that focuses on the analysis and testing of metals and minerals. These labs are equipped with a range of instruments and equipment, including spectrometers, microscopes, and furnaces, which are used to determine the chemical composition, physical properties, and microstructure of metals and minerals. Metallurgical labs can be found in universities, research institutions, and industrial settings, where they play a critical role in supporting research and development, quality control, and problem-solving.

2. Functions of a Metallurgical Lab

Metallurgical labs perform a variety of functions, including:

* Chemical analysis: Determining the chemical composition of metals and minerals using techniques such as atomic absorption spectroscopy (AAS), inductively coupled plasma mass spectrometry (ICP-MS), and X-ray fluorescence (XRF).
* Physical testing: Measuring the physical properties of metals and minerals, such as hardness, tensile strength, and density, using techniques such as tensile testing, impact testing, and density measurement.
* Microstructural analysis: Examining the microstructure of metals and minerals using techniques such as scanning electron microscopy (SEM), transmission electron microscopy (TEM), and optical microscopy.
* Corrosion testing: Evaluating the resistance of metals and alloys to corrosion using techniques such as electrochemical impedance spectroscopy (EIS) and potentiodynamic polarization.

3. Techniques Used in Metallurgical Labs

Metallurgical labs employ a range of techniques to analyze and test metals and minerals. Some of the most common techniques include:

* Spectroscopy: Using instruments such as AAS, ICP-MS, and XRF to determine the chemical composition of metals and minerals.
* Microscopy: Using instruments such as SEM, TEM, and optical microscopy to examine the microstructure of metals and minerals.
* Thermal analysis: Using techniques such as differential scanning calorimetry (DSC) and thermogravimetry (TG) to study the thermal properties of metals and minerals.
* Mechanical testing: Using techniques such as tensile testing, impact testing, and hardness testing to measure the physical properties of metals and minerals.

4. Importance of Metallurgical Labs

Metallurgical labs play a critical role in the field of metallurgy, providing scientists and engineers with the tools and expertise needed to analyze and characterize the physical and chemical properties of metals and minerals. The importance of metallurgical labs can be seen in several areas:

* Research and development: Metallurgical labs support research and development by providing scientists with the tools and expertise needed to develop new materials and technologies.
* Quality control: Metallurgical labs play a critical role in ensuring the quality of metals and minerals by testing and analyzing their physical and chemical properties.
* Problem-solving: Metallurgical labs help to solve problems related to metal and mineral processing, corrosion, and failure analysis.

5. Applications of Metallurgical Labs

Metallurgical labs have a wide range of applications in various industries, including:

* Mining and mineral processing: Metallurgical labs are used to analyze and test the physical and chemical properties of ores and minerals.
* Materials science: Metallurgical labs are used to develop and characterize new materials and technologies.
* Corrosion control: Metallurgical labs are used to evaluate the resistance of metals and alloys to corrosion.
* Failure analysis: Metallurgical labs are used to investigate the causes of failure in metals and alloys.

Comprehending Business Building: An Extensive Introduction

Business construction is a vital industry of the construction industry that focuses on structure and restoring frameworks intended for company use. This can vary from retail stores and office complex to stockrooms and commercial centers. With the fast development of urban advancement and the raising need for industrial areas, recognizing the ins and outs of business building has actually never been more important. This post covers the vital aspects that define this vibrant self-control, highlighting its types, difficulties, and future trends.

One of the defining characteristics of industrial building is the selection of tasks it includes. The sorts of commercial structures include, but are not restricted to, workplaces, dining establishments, resorts, shopping malls, and health care centers. Each project includes its very own set of specifications, regulations, and layout factors to consider. For example, making a high-rise office complex needs a solid focus on both performance and looks, while a warehouse may focus on logistical effectiveness over intricate style attributes. Recognizing the particular requirements of each task kind is necessary for successful implementation in business building.

The commercial building process is complex and generally includes several stages. It starts with preparation and design, where engineers and engineers collaborate to create plans that show both the client’s vision and governing demands. Following this, the job goes on to protecting licenses, procurement of products, and ultimately, the real building and construction work. Each phase needs to be carefully handled to make sure timelines and budgets are followed, which requires reliable communication amongst all stakeholders included, consisting of specialists, subcontractors, and suppliers.

In spite of its possibilities, commercial construction can be fraught with obstacles. Elements like fluctuating product prices, labor shortages, and governing modifications can impact timelines and budgets dramatically. Furthermore, as innovation developments, remaining updated with the latest construction fads, such as lasting building techniques and wise technology combination, is crucial for business aiming to continue to be affordable. Overcoming these difficulties frequently needs ingenious solutions and an aggressive strategy to task monitoring.

Looking in advance, the future of business building shows up encouraging, particularly with the rise in lasting building and construction practices. Extra companies are prioritizing environment-friendly materials and energy-efficient layouts, replying to both consumer demand and regulative stress regarding ecological effect. In addition, developments in construction modern technology, such as Building Info Modeling (BIM) and modular construction methods, are expected to boost performance and lower prices. As the landscape progresses, welcoming these modifications will not just improve job end results but will certainly likewise play an essential role in reshaping the business building market.
